Understanding Utility Bill Consolidation
Utility bill consolidation replaces multiple location-specific invoices with one unified statement covering your entire portfolio. The consolidation provider enrolls each utility account, tracks usage across all locations, aggregates charges, and generates a single invoice with granular breakdowns by site [1].
This differs from dual billing, where commercial energy customers in deregulated markets receive separate invoices from the utility company and the energy supplier. Dual billing creates accounting complexity and cash flow challenges, particularly for mid-market enterprises managing multiple locations [5]. Consolidated billing combines all charges into one statement, often with negotiated payment terms that improve predictability.

The consolidation process starts with account enrollment. The provider establishes relationships with each utility serving your locations, whether that's 15 accounts or 150. As meters record usage, data flows to the consolidation platform. Charges accumulate throughout the billing cycle, then the platform generates your consolidated invoice showing total costs alongside location-specific details [4].
For finance teams, this means one payment replaces dozens. Your accounts payable workflow shifts from processing 20+ utility invoices monthly to reviewing a single comprehensive statement. The administrative impact extends beyond payment processing. Traditional utility management requires contract tracking across multiple providers, invoice validation for each location, and dispute resolution that spans different billing systems. Consolidation centralizes these workflows. When a billing issue arises, you work with one platform instead of contacting multiple utility companies.
Modern consolidation platforms integrate with enterprise resource planning systems, enabling automated data export for financial reporting. Instead of manual data entry from disparate invoices, utility expenses flow directly into your general ledger with proper coding by location, cost center, or department [7].
Benefits and Drawbacks for Modern CFOs
The primary benefit of utility bill consolidation is spending visibility across your entire portfolio. When utility costs arrive in 20 separate invoices, identifying patterns requires manual consolidation. A consolidated platform provides immediate portfolio-wide analytics: which locations consume the most energy, where usage trends up or down, how costs compare to budgeted amounts.
This visibility enables benchmarking. With unified data, CFOs can compare similar locations to identify outliers. Why does the Dallas location cost 30% more than the Houston location of similar size? Consolidated data surfaces these questions automatically, rather than requiring finance teams to build comparison spreadsheets manually.

Consolidation prevents missed payments that lead to late fees or service interruptions. When managing numerous utility accounts, the risk of overlooking an invoice increases. A single consolidated bill with centralized payment reduces this operational risk.
The financial benefits extend across operations: cash flow becomes predictable with one payment date instead of 15-20 scattered due dates monthly, automated validation reduces billing errors before payment, accounts payable hours drop 75-85%, real-time data enables forecasting within 3-5% variance, and centralized tracking eliminates late fees.
However, traditional consolidated billing carried drawbacks. In deregulated markets, some consolidation approaches led to higher rates compared to dual billing, where businesses could negotiate specialized payment terms with suppliers. Service interruption risk also increased if non-payment affected the entire portfolio rather than individual locations.
The key distinction for modern CFOs is between passive consolidation and active optimization. Traditional bill pay agents consolidate invoices but charge per-bill fees ($10-15 monthly) without delivering savings. They improve administrative efficiency without addressing the underlying question: are these bills accurate?
Automated bill auditing identifies errors that traditional consolidation misses. Industry data shows billing errors appear in 18-20% of utility invoices [8]. These errors span incorrect meter readings, wrong rate classifications, tariff application mistakes, and billing system glitches. Without automated validation, even a consolidated invoice may contain thousands of dollars in overcharges.
AI-driven consolidation platforms combine the administrative benefits of single-invoice billing with systematic error detection. These platforms validate every line item against tariff schedules, flag rate anomalies, identify usage patterns that signal operational issues, and automatically file disputes when errors occur. This delivers cost savings (typically 5-15% of utility spend) alongside the organizational benefits of consolidation.

Limitations
Not all billing errors are detectable through automation alone. AI excels at catching tariff mismatches, duplicate charges, and rate classification errors. However, meter tampering, unauthorized usage, and physical infrastructure issues require on-site verification. A comprehensive approach combines AI validation with periodic manual audits for locations showing unexplained usage patterns. Organizations relying solely on automated checking may miss 15-20% of error types that manifest as legitimate-looking charges.
Beyond basic bill accuracy, AI delivers strategic insights. Pattern recognition identifies usage anomalies that signal operational problems: sudden consumption spikes indicating HVAC malfunction, equipment running outside business hours, or unauthorized meter access. The Operational Insights Hiding in Your Utility Bills research shows these insights uncover hundreds of thousands in losses. Rate optimization happens continuously too. AI analyzes consumption patterns across all locations, models costs under different tariff structures, and identifies reclassification opportunities when beneficial.

Streamlining Accounts Payable with Consolidation
Accounts payable complexity scales linearly with location count under traditional utility management. Each location generates monthly invoices from one or more utilities. A 15-location portfolio produces 180+ annual invoices requiring individual processing and approval.
Consolidation compresses this workflow to 12 annual invoices (one monthly statement covering all locations). The AP efficiency gain is immediate: fewer invoices to process, fewer payments to schedule, fewer vendor relationships to manage.
The consolidation invoice provides location-level detail that supports your existing approval workflows. Finance directors can review costs by site, comparing actuals to budgets before approving payment. Regional managers see expenses for their locations without accessing 15 different utility portals. The single invoice structure doesn't eliminate oversight; it centralizes it.
Accounts Payable Workflow Transformation:
Traditional Multi-Location Process: Invoice receipt (20 invoices) → Data entry (3-4 hours) → Approval routing (5-7 business days across regions) → Payment scheduling (tracking 20 due dates) → Reconciliation (2-3 hours monthly) → Dispute management (contacting 8-12 utilities) → Total monthly burden: 18-22 AP hours
Consolidated Process: Single invoice receipt → Automated data validation (5 minutes) → Centralized approval (1-2 business days) → One payment date → Automated reconciliation (15 minutes) → Single-point dispute resolution → Total monthly burden: 2-3 AP hours
Payment processing simplifies further when the consolidation provider offers direct payment services. Instead of your AP team cutting checks or scheduling ACH payments to multiple utilities, the platform handles all utility payments. You approve the consolidated invoice and remit one payment to the consolidation provider, who distributes funds to each utility.
This model improves cash flow predictability. Rather than tracking different payment due dates for 20 utilities (some requiring payment by the 15th, others by the 20th, some offering early payment discounts), you work with one consistent billing cycle and payment schedule.
The administrative time savings accumulate across finance operations. Contract management shifts from tracking dozens of utility service agreements to one consolidation platform agreement. Dispute resolution happens through a single channel rather than navigating different utility customer service departments. Audit preparation pulls from one consolidated data source instead of gathering files from multiple providers.
For mid-market enterprises where finance teams manage utility costs alongside numerous other responsibilities, this streamlining prevents utility management from consuming disproportionate time. The finance director at a 20-location restaurant chain shouldn't spend hours monthly validating utility invoices. Consolidation redirects that time to higher-value analysis.
Integration with existing financial systems extends the efficiency gain. Modern consolidation platforms export data in formats compatible with major ERP systems, enabling automated posting to the general ledger with proper account coding. Month-end close accelerates when utility expenses don't require manual journal entries from multiple source documents.
Key Considerations for Choosing a Consolidation Service
Service scope: Verify the provider supports all utility types (electric, gas, water, waste) across every state where you operate. Multi-location enterprises need comprehensive coverage, not just energy consolidation.
Pricing model: Traditional bill pay agents charge $10-15 per invoice regardless of savings found. That's $1,800-$2,700 annually for a 10-location business with zero guaranteed cost reduction. Performance-based pricing aligns incentives: the provider shares in savings discovered, so you pay for results.
Pricing Model Comparison:
- Per-transaction model: $10-15 per invoice monthly, predictable cost but no savings guarantee
- Flat monthly fee: $200-500+ monthly regardless of location count, suitable for stable portfolios
- Performance-based sharing: Provider retains 30-50% of savings found, aligns incentives with results
- Hybrid model: Small base fee + performance sharing, balances predictability with results alignment
- Tiered pricing: Cost per location decreases as portfolio grows, rewards scale
Technology and audit capabilities: The difference between basic consolidation and strategic platforms comes down to automated bill validation, AI-driven anomaly detection, and location-level benchmarking. Ask providers for specific examples of billing errors found and savings recovered for similar clients.
Portfolio visibility: Platforms should offer real-time dashboards, customizable reports by location or cost center, and exportable data. The goal is enhanced financial visibility, not just fewer invoices.
Implementation and support: For multi-location portfolios, implementation complexity scales with location count. Confirm the provider has experience with portfolio-scale deployments and responsive support for billing issues.

FAQs about Utility Bill Consolidation
What types of businesses benefit most from utility bill consolidation?
Multi-location enterprises with 10+ sites see the greatest benefit. Restaurant chains, retail portfolios, hotel groups, fitness franchises, and healthcare facilities manage enough utility accounts that consolidation delivers significant administrative efficiency and cost optimization. Single-location businesses may not justify the platform investment.
Does consolidation work across different utility providers and states?
Yes. Consolidation platforms work with utilities nationwide, handling different providers, rate structures, and regulatory environments. Whether your locations span two states or twenty, the platform enrolls accounts with each utility and consolidates them into one invoice.
How long does implementation take?
Account enrollment typically requires 30-60 days depending on portfolio size and utility responsiveness. The consolidation provider contacts each utility to establish the relationship, verify account details, and coordinate billing. Once enrolled, consolidated invoicing begins the following billing cycle.
Will I lose control or visibility with consolidated billing?
Modern platforms increase visibility compared to managing individual utility invoices. You see portfolio-wide analytics, location-level detail, usage trends, and cost comparisons (insights difficult to generate manually from disparate bills). Access controls allow different team members to view relevant data for their locations or regions.
What happens if there's a billing dispute or service issue?
The consolidation provider handles utility communication and dispute resolution. When errors appear, they file disputes with the utility and track resolution. You work with one point of contact rather than navigating multiple utility customer service departments. Service issues are escalated according to your specified procedures.
How do performance-based consolidation services differ from traditional bill pay agents?
Traditional agents charge monthly fees per location for invoice processing and payment but don't audit bills or find savings. Performance-based platforms share in savings discovered through automated bill validation, charging you only when they reduce your costs. The economic model aligns the provider's success with your savings.
Can consolidation platforms integrate with our existing accounting systems?
Enterprise-grade platforms export data compatible with major ERP systems, enabling automated GL posting with proper account coding. This integration eliminates manual data entry from utility invoices and accelerates month-end close.
What cost savings should I expect from bill consolidation?
Administrative efficiency comes immediately through reduced invoice processing and centralized payment. Cost savings from automated bill auditing typically range 5-15% of utility spend when errors are identified and recovered. Actual savings depend on current billing accuracy and optimization opportunities in your portfolio.
